How to Commission a New Thermostat During Its First Week

A new thermostat needs a careful first week before it becomes part of everyday life. Commissioning means confirming that the control, HVAC equipment, and household routine work together. It is not feature shopping or a search for a perfect schedule on the first day. A few measured checks can uncover incorrect setup, uneven comfort, or equipment behavior that deserves professional attention.

Put safety ahead of convenience. Stop using the system and contact a qualified HVAC or electrical professional if you smell burning, see damaged wiring, hear persistent electrical buzzing, or have a breaker trip. Do not open equipment panels beyond homeowner access, bypass safety switches, or work on energized wiring. Thermostats can connect to heat pumps, boilers, humidifiers, and controls with requirements that need trained diagnosis.

  1. Record the starting point.

On day one, check that the thermostat’s time, date, and system type are correct. Note whether the home uses a furnace, boiler, central air conditioner, heat pump, or multiple zones. Record the indoor temperature, outdoor conditions, and how the main room feels. If possible, place a reliable room thermometer nearby for 15 minutes and compare readings. A small difference can be normal; a consistently large one calls for checking placement, calibration guidance, or a professional.

  1. Test heating, cooling, and the fan separately.

When conditions permit, select Heat and raise the target just a few degrees above room temperature. Allow the normal startup delay, then confirm that heat arrives. At another time, select Cool, lower the target a few degrees, and confirm cool air. Set the fan to Auto and verify that it stops after the equipment finishes; briefly test On if the model provides it. Do not flip quickly between heating and cooling. Wait several minutes between changes to protect the compressor.

  1. Watch the location and system response.

For the next two or three days, notice whether direct sun, cooking, showers, fireplaces, or an exterior door affect the reading. A thermostat in afternoon sun may stop cooling too early, while one in a draft may call for extra heat. Listen for short cycling: equipment starting and stopping every few minutes without stabilizing the room. Do not change wiring to solve either issue. Log the time and conditions, then call an HVAC technician if the pattern continues.

  1. Create a simple temporary schedule.

Start with only the household’s predictable blocks: wake-up, daytime, evening, and sleep. Choose comfortable targets rather than extreme setbacks. The first week’s purpose is to learn whether the home reaches each target reliably. Use a temporary hold for a genuine exception, such as guests or illness. If daily holds become necessary, they show that the base schedule needs revision; they should not become a permanent workaround.

  1. Check comfort throughout the home.

At similar times each day, visit the rooms people use most. Note areas that stay too warm, too cool, humid, or stuffy. Make sure supply and return vents are unobstructed and leave interior doors as the installer recommends. Avoid closing many vents to force air elsewhere, since that can reduce airflow and affect equipment operation. Persistent differences can involve insulation, ducts, balancing, zoning, or sensors rather than a thermostat setting.

  1. Confirm alerts, access, and recovery.

Test essentials for a busy household: battery status where applicable, Wi-Fi connection if used, and whether another responsible adult can operate the control. Review maintenance reminders as prompts, not diagnoses. If a fault code appears, photograph it, record the time, and consult the manufacturer’s instructions or a technician. Avoid repeated resets, which may erase useful evidence.

Consider Maya and Jordan, who installed a thermostat in a two-story home with central air and a gas furnace. Monday’s brief heating and cooling tests passed. By Wednesday, their upstairs bedroom stayed warm at bedtime although downstairs was comfortable. Instead of lowering the whole-house temperature every night, they logged temperatures, cleared a blocked return-air grille, and used a modest sleep setting. When the room remained warm, they booked an HVAC visit to assess airflow. Their notes gave the technician useful facts instead of guesses.

Common mistakes include setting extreme temperatures to make equipment work faster, changing several settings at once, leaving the clock wrong, and treating one uncomfortable hour as proof that the thermostat failed. A connected thermostat cannot repair a dirty filter, failed part, refrigerant problem, or unsafe combustion condition. It can only request heating or cooling.

At week’s end, keep the schedule that provided steady comfort, document unresolved patterns, and make one small adjustment at a time. A successfully commissioned thermostat calls for heating and cooling predictably, fits the household’s actual routine, and makes it clear when a system issue belongs with a qualified professional.
